-
Performance: Performance in RGB fans is defined by airflow and static pressure. High airflow allows for improved cooling, while static pressure is important for forcing air through dense components like heat sinks. A fan that generates 70 CFM (cubic feet per minute) of airflow combined with a static pressure of 3.0 mmH2O can effectively cool components in a computer case.
-
Aesthetics: Aesthetics pertain to the visual appeal of RGB fans. Many users choose RGB fans to enhance their build’s appearance. Fans often have addressable RGB lighting, which enables customizable colors and effects. For example, a setup featuring Corsair LL120 fans with customizable lighting can create dynamic visual displays, thus appealing to gamers and PC enthusiasts who prioritize style.
-
Compatibility: Compatibility concerns both the physical fit and integration with existing hardware and software. Fans may vary in size (120mm, 140mm, etc.), which impacts fitting into cases. Additionally, ensuring that the fans connect properly to the motherboard or RGB controller is crucial. Many fans support standards like ARGB and RGB headers, making them versatile across different systems.
-
Noise Level: Noise level is an essential factor, especially in silent builds. Fans are rated in decibels (dBA), and a quieter fan might operate around 20-25 dBA. Selecting a fan with vibration-reducing technology can further minimize noise. Research indicates that fans designed with fluid dynamic bearing technology tend to run quieter and last longer.
-
Software Control: Software control allows for advanced customization of fan speeds and RGB effects through programs like ASUS Aura or MSI Mystic Light. Fans that support software control typically offer more synchronized lighting effects and the ability to create fan speed profiles based on temperature readings. This functionality can enhance both performance and user experience, as seen in builds using MSI Mystic Light Sync to coordinate lighting patterns across multiple components.
How Does Airflow Impact the Cooling Performance of RGB Fans?
Airflow significantly impacts the cooling performance of RGB fans. RGB fans generate airflow that helps dissipate heat from components in a computer case. When fans spin, they create a flow of air that can either push or pull hot air away from heat sources, like the CPU or GPU.
Higher airflow increases the volume of air moved per minute, enhancing cooling performance. When airflow is optimal, it prevents heat buildup, leading to improved temperatures for critical components.
Conversely, restricted airflow decreases cooling efficiency. Blocked fan blades or inadequate case ventilation can trap hot air inside the case instead of expelling it. This situation can lead to increased temperatures, causing thermal throttling in components.
A fan’s design affects its airflow performance. Blades with a specific shape or curvature can enhance airflow, increasing efficiency. Additionally, the placement of fans within the case influences airflow patterns. Fans located at the front can draw cool air in, while those at the back or top can expel warm air effectively.
RGB lighting does not affect the airflow directly but can attract more attention to fan aesthetics. However, having efficient airflow remains crucial for maintaining optimal cooling performance in systems equipped with RGB fans.
Why Is Fan Noise Level a Critical Factor in Your Decision?
Fan noise level is a critical factor in your decision because it affects your comfort and concentration in an environment. Loud fans can create distractions and disrupt work or leisure activities.
According to the U.S. Environmental Protection Agency (EPA), noise is defined as any unwanted or disturbing sound that can have negative effects on health and well-being. This means that high fan noise levels may lead to stress, decreased productivity, and discomfort.
The underlying causes of fan noise typically stem from the design and components of the fan. Three main reasons for noise generation include the speed of the fan blades, the types of materials used, and the overall design of the fan. Higher speeds often increase airflow but also generate more noise. Fans made from harder materials can create harsher sounds, while poorly designed fans may have vibrations that contribute to the noise.
Terms such as “decibel level” (dB) are important for understanding fan noise. The decibel scale measures sound intensity; a lower decibel level indicates quieter sound. For instance, a fan operating at 30 dB is generally considered quiet, while one at 60 dB is much louder and may be disruptive.
The mechanisms involved in fan noise include airflow turbulence and vibration. When fan blades slice through the air, they can create turbulent airflow, leading to additional noise. Vibration occurs when fan components are not securely fixed, causing them to move and generate sound.
Specific conditions that contribute to fan noise include inadequate maintenance, improper installation, and environmental factors. For example, a fan that is not cleaned regularly can gather dust, which may increase noise levels. Additionally, if a fan is placed in a confined space, sound can amplify, making it seem noisier than it actually is.
